One of the things I love most about this recipe is its adaptability. The protein is completely interchangeable. Ground beef, pork, or even chicken all work wonderfully. I personally prefer pork, finding its richness complements the other ingredients perfectly. Feel free to experiment with different vegetables too; Adding bell peppers, broccoli florets, or even mushrooms would be a fantastic way to incorporate more nutrients and adjust the flavors to your liking.

Tips and Tricks for Egg Roll Skillet Perfection:
Vegetable Prep: To save time, I often shred the cabbage and prep the carrots ahead of time. I'll store them in airtight containers in the refrigerator for a couple of days, making weeknight cooking a breeze.
Sauce Balance: The sauce is the star of this dish. Don't be afraid to adjust the amount of soy sauce and rice vinegar to your taste preference. A little extra ginger adds a fantastic warmth and depth of flavor.
Garnishes: While green onions are a lovely garnish, a sprinkle of toasted sesame seeds adds a nice textural contrast and extra nutty flavor.
Leftovers: This dish is equally delicious the next day! The flavors meld beautifully overnight, making it a perfect meal prep option. I often pack it for my lunch the following day.
